Ansonia's game on Monday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Tuesday. They came out on top against the Fairlawn Jets by a score of 6-3. The victory continues a trend for the Tigers in their matchups with the Jets: they've now won four in a row.

Lander Shives made a splash while hitting and pitching. On the mound, he tossed five innings while giving up three earned runs off five hits. He has been consistent recently: he hasn't tossed less than five strikeouts in four consecutive appearances. He was also solid in the batter's box, going 2-for-3 with one triple, one run, and one RBI.

In other batting news, the team relied heavily on Darby Gilland, who went a perfect 3-for-3 with two RBI, one run, and one double. Those three hits gave him a new career-high. Asher Shives was another key player, going 2-for-4 with two runs, one stolen base, and one RBI.

Ansonia kept the outfield on their toes and finished the game with 11 hits. That's the most hits they've managed all season.

Ansonia's win bumped their record up to 3-7. As for Fairlawn, their defeat was their fifth straight at home, which dropped their record down to 2-9.

Looking ahead, Ansonia will head out to challenge Mississinawa Valley at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Fairlawn, they will welcome Russia at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. The Raiders' pitching crew has only allowed 3.5 runs per game this season, so the Jets' hitters will have their work cut out for them.
